Hooray for me. Darn, I almost finished the game on 1 credit. I bet I could have if I'd played a bit more. I was far into level 5, the airstrip, on my best game. It throws a free guy at you every 30k, & there's as free guy dropped via parachute on levels 2 & 4. The only really hard places where it took many repeated tried to figure out a solution (rather than just have good reflexes & luck) was the helicopter on level 2 (go super fast along the top until you can jump to the bottom bridge, then, as soon as you land, tap the stick right to get back up to full speed to avoid the copter's bullets) & a later section in level 2 where the road angles up & 5 missiles drop from the sky, covering the road, while a vehicle sprays fire at you (again, go fast & jump over all that stuff & try not to die when you land in the midst of more fire). I like that you can land on top of vehicles to kill them, too. Fun.
